Equilibrium sheets measure what a business possesses and owes. This kind of declaration provides a snapshot of a small company's financial wellness at a details point. Bookkeepers can view the company's properties and obligation numbers at a look. Business generally prepare balance sheets at the end of every quarter, yet individuals can prepare them at any kind of time.
Shareholders' equity stands for a company's web worth the quantity shareholders would obtain if they sold off all possessions and repaid all financial debts. Total assets can additionally be understood as assets minus responsibilities. For example, a firm with $10,000 in possessions and $2,000 in responsibilities would certainly have an $8,000 investors' equity. Revenue statements, often referred to as earnings and loss declarations, sum up a local business's incomes and expenses over a specific duration.
Revenue declarations concentrate on 4 essential items profits, gains, expenses, and losses which bookkeepers make use of to determine take-home pay. Earnings includes operating and non-operating income. Running income makes up an organization's main activities, like marketing products. Companies get non-operating profits via second service tasks, like savings account interest. Gains include cash made from one-time, non-business tasks, like liquidating old devices or extra buildings.

Capital statements sum up the quantity of cash going into and leaving a business. These statements focus solely on liquid assets like money and browse around these guys money equivalents investments that people can conveniently develop into money. Accountants calculate capital by making adjustments to a service's earnings declaration. site Via enhancement and reduction, accountants eliminate non-cash things and purchases from the earnings.
